What is the format and duration of the personality test conducted by UPSC? 🔊
The format of the Personality Test conducted by UPSC is an interview process that lasts approximately 30-40 minutes. It assesses a candidate's personality, intellect, and suitability for a career in civil services. The test panel typically consists of experts, including a Chairman and members from varied backgrounds. Candidates are evaluated based on their responses to questions concerning personal background, current affairs, and general awareness. Unlike the written exams, this test emphasizes the interpersonal skills, attitude, and decision-making abilities of candidates, which are crucial for effective governance.
